What This Calculator Does
The Solar Panel Cost Calculator estimates the cost of installing a residential solar panel system based on your home size, energy usage, and 2026 US national average pricing. Enter your monthly electric bill and home size to get system size and cost estimates.
Solar panel installations have grown significantly, with federal tax incentives (30% Investment Tax Credit) making systems more affordable in 2026. System costs have decreased approximately 70% over the past decade, making solar increasingly accessible for US homeowners.

Reference Table
| Home Size | System Size | Before Tax Credit | After 30% Credit | Est. Payback |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1,200 sq ft | 5 kW | $12.5K-$17.5K | $8.8K-$12.3K | 7-10 years |
| 1,800 sq ft | 7 kW | $17.5K-$24.5K | $12.3K-$17.2K | 7-11 years |
| 2,400 sq ft | 9 kW | $22.5K-$31.5K | $15.8K-$22.1K | 8-12 years |
| 3,000 sq ft | 11 kW | $27.5K-$38.5K | $19.3K-$27K | 8-12 years |
